    The Story Behind Olguita

    Olguita is a Spanish diminutive of the Slavic name Olga. The name Olga itself is derived from the Old Norse name Helga, meaning 'holy' or 'blessed'. It was introduced to Kievan Rus' (an early East Slavic state) through Scandinavian influence, particularly with Saint Olga of Kyiv, who was a powerful and influential ruler in the 10th century. The diminutive suffix '-ita' is common in Spanish and Portuguese, used to convey endearment or smallness.

    While Olga has a long and significant history in Eastern Europe, its diminutive form Olguita is primarily used in Spanish-speaking cultures. It carries the same core meaning of 'holy' or 'blessed' but with an added layer of affection and familiarity. The name is less common than its root form but is recognized as a sweet and traditional choice in its cultural context.
